Coughlin and Ryan support Garcia in win over Titans

Mike Coughlin and Michael Ryan each went 4-for-5 and Fabian Garcia struck out five over six solid innings to help St. Ambrose to a 4-3 win over Indiana South Bend at Route 66 Stadium in Joliet, Ill., Tuesday night.

Coughlin scored a run and drove in two while Ryan knocked in what proved to be the game winner with an RBI single in the sixth.

Ryan's run-scoring hit came on the heels of Coughlin's RBI single and gave the Bees a 4-0 lead in the top of the sixth. An inning earlier, Coughlin got SAU on the board with a double to score Liam Dennehy and he later came around to score on Andrew Rodriguez's single as part of a two-run frame.

Garcia allowed six hits over his six innings to pick up the win. Four of those hits, including a three-run home run, came in the bottom of the sixth inning which allowed the Titans to close the gap to 4-3.

But Jack Staten entered in the seventh and closed out the victory. He stranded a pair of Indiana South Bend base runners in both the seventh and eighth innings before retiring the side in order in the ninth to earn the save. Staten struck out three.

Dennehy finished 3-for-4 as he, Coughlin and Ryan combined for 11 of the Bees' 14 hits. Rodriguez, Noah Powless and Peyton Minder also had hits in the win that moved SAU to 11-18 overall and 9-8 in CCAC play.

The two teams' scheduled doubleheader for Wednesday in Clinton, Iowa, has been postponed. No makeup date has been announced. St. Ambrose is now next scheduled to play a single game at Trinity Christian Friday afternoon before heading to Bensenville, Ill., to complete a suspended game against Robert Morris that night. The Bees lead 6-1 in the fifth inning of that contest.
